Back log of 900 whistle-blower lawsuits at Department of Justice

Whistle-blower lawsuits alleging that pharmaceutical companies and government contractors defrauded the federal government have created a backlog of more than 900 cases at the Department of Justice, the Washington Post reports. According to the Post, more than 500 of the cases involve the health care and pharmaceutical industries, as well as Medicare and Medicaid.

Decipher genomic analysis platform predicts tumor responsiveness to neoadjuvant chemotherapy in MIBC patients

GenomeDx Biosciences today announced that the robust Decipher genomic analysis platform, successfully classified various subtypes of bladder cancer based on the genomic expression of certain biomarkers, including one type associated with resistance to cisplatin-based chemotherapy. Importantly, this unique genomic signature has potential as a tool to predict tumor responsiveness to neoadjuvant chemotherapy in patients with muscle-invasive bladder cancers (MIBC).

Researchers design global plan for sustainable agriculture

The problem is stark: One billion people on earth don't have enough food right now. It's estimated that by 2050 there will be more than nine billion people living on the planet. Meanwhile, current agricultural practices are amongst the biggest threats to the global environment. This means that if we don't develop more sustainable practices, the planet will become even less able to feed its growing population than it is today.
